Institutional Capacity

People, facilities, and additional resources are all fundamental to better serving the Langara community. To continue to grow Langara, we will focus on these resource priorities:

People

Continue to develop career opportunities and a working environment that values and supports our current employees and allows Langara to be known as the preferred employer for faculty, staff, and administrators. This will be accomplished by providing a variety of career options and opportunities that reflect changing requirements for all groups. Through this, the institution will also address succession planning, leadership development, and professional advancement that supports the College and its employees, and the recruitment and retention of the best individuals across all positions.

Facilities

Develop the facilities required for the delivery of our current programming and services, taking into consideration the ongoing growth and development of the institution. This means that we have the required space to support our learners, employees, communities, and the opportunities we offer.

Technology

Establish technology as a strategic imperative of the institution. This will be reflected in the ongoing implementation of technology in a timely way that keeps Langara on pace with advances in educational technology, communications, and other initiatives relevant to post-secondary education.

Financial Resources

Continue to be a fiscally responsible organization that is financially resilient and sustainable. This means there will be an ongoing expansion of current revenue generation activities in order to provide the financial flexibility required for innovation, development, and the ability to take advantage of new opportunities. This requires the development of a college advancement program that provides the fundraising capacity for facilities development, scholarships and bursaries for students, and other needs as required.
